Bavarian Nordic Receives USD 50 Million Advance Payment From the U.S. Government for Fulfilling Contract Milestones.

PR Newswire Europe, October, 2007

Content provided in partnership with HighBeam Research

KVISTGARD, Denmark, October 8 /PRNewswire/ -- Bavarian Nordic has received permission from the U.S. authorities to invoice an advance payment of USD 50 million as allowed under the RFP-3 contract to manufacture and deliver 20 million doses of the company's, IMVAMUNE(R) smallpox vaccine. The permission has been granted because the company has fulfilled a number of significant milestones in the contract.

The income will be recognised as revenue in the financial statements as the vaccines are delivered. Delivery will start once an Emergency Use Authorization for IMVAMUNE(R) is granted.
